Marie-Josephe ROY was born 4 April 1738 in Pointe-Claire, Montréal, Canada, New France

Marie-Josephe ROY was the child of François ROY   and   Marie-Charlotte CHAMAILLARD and the grandchild of: (paternal)  André ROY and Jeanne PÉLADEAU dite ST-JEAN (maternal)  Jean-Baptiste CHAMAILLARD and Marie MATOU (MATHON) dite LABRIE

Spouse(s)/Partner(s) and Child(ren):

Marie-Josephe  married  Louis DENIS dit ST DENIS 19 January 1761 in Pointe-Claire, Montréal, Canada .  The couple had (at least) 1 child.
Louis DENIS dit ST DENIS  was born 29 April 1734 in Pointe-Claire, Montréal, Québec, Canada (Saint-Joachim-de-la-Pointe-Claire).  Louis died 18 May 1764 in Sainte-Anne-de-Bellevue, Montréal, Québec, Canada.  Louis was the child of Jacques DENIS and Marie-Anne PICARD.
Did You Know? Québec Généalogie - Over time, Québec has gone through a series of name changes
From its inception in the early 1600s until 1760, it was called Canada, New France.
1760 to 1763, it was simply Canada
1763 to 1791 - Province of Québec
1791 to 1867 - Lower Canada
1867 to present - Québec, Canada.
